jquery索引 jquery實(shí)現(xiàn)搜索功能

jquery中怎么獲得當(dāng)前元素的索引值

1、可以使用prev函數(shù),一直查找前一個(gè)元素并計(jì)數(shù),直到?jīng)]有前一個(gè)元素。根據(jù)計(jì)數(shù),可以知道當(dāng)前的索引值。

網(wǎng)站建設(shè)哪家好,找創(chuàng)新互聯(lián)建站!專注于網(wǎng)頁(yè)設(shè)計(jì)、網(wǎng)站建設(shè)、微信開發(fā)、微信小程序開發(fā)、集團(tuán)企業(yè)網(wǎng)站建設(shè)等服務(wù)項(xiàng)目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了會(huì)澤免費(fèi)建站歡迎大家使用!

2、jquery提供了獲得第一個(gè)匹配元素相對(duì)于其同胞元素的位置的方法——index(),注意:index從0開始計(jì)數(shù) 如果未找到元素,index() 將返回 -1。

3、如果想簡(jiǎn)單的放用Jquery很方便就可以獲取。

4、td是列,tr是行: (document).ready(function(){ (table td).bind(click,function(){ var index = $(this).parent().index();alert(index);//表示所在行的索引。

5、這是一個(gè)段落。這是一個(gè)段落。這是一個(gè)段落。這是一個(gè)段落。這是一個(gè)段落。這是一個(gè)段落。

jquery中怎么獲得特定元素的索引值

可以使用prev函數(shù),一直查找前一個(gè)元素并計(jì)數(shù),直到?jīng)]有前一個(gè)元素。根據(jù)計(jì)數(shù),可以知道當(dāng)前的索引值。

jQuery 中使用 text() 或者 html() 函數(shù)可以獲取td的內(nèi)容:(td).text(); // 或者 $(td).html();二者區(qū)別在于前者返回所選元素的文本內(nèi)容,后者返回所選元素的內(nèi)容(包括 HTML 標(biāo)記)。

jquery提供了獲得第一個(gè)匹配元素相對(duì)于其同胞元素的位置的方法——index(),注意:index從0開始計(jì)數(shù) 如果未找到元素,index() 將返回 -1。

在index.html中的標(biāo)簽,輸入jquery代碼:(body).append($(div).text());(body).append($(input).val());瀏覽器運(yùn)行index.html頁(yè)面,此時(shí)通過jquery獲取到了div元素中的內(nèi)容和input標(biāo)簽的值。

jQuery實(shí)現(xiàn)select下拉框獲取當(dāng)前選中文本、值、索引

(selector).val(value)val() 方法返回或設(shè)置被選元素的值。元素的值是通過 value 屬性設(shè)置的。該方法大多用于 input 元素。如果該方法未設(shè)置參數(shù),則返回被選元素的當(dāng)前值。

JS: document.getElementById(sid).value;Jquery: $(#sid).val();直接就可以獲取指定select的選中的值;如果是多選的話,需要用其他方法。

另外,這個(gè)Select下拉框也可以綁定下拉事件,并獲取當(dāng)前選中項(xiàng)的值。

輸入jquery代碼:(select option).each(function (i) { if ($(this).attr(selected)) { (body).append(i);} });瀏覽器運(yùn)行index.html頁(yè)面,此時(shí)用jquery獲取到了option的索引值被打印了出來。

創(chuàng)建如下結(jié)構(gòu)的測(cè)試文件-- Content,-- jquery-1min.js,-- JquerySelect.html?!精@取】下拉框【選中值】:使用【.val()】。

如何用jquery獲得option的索引值index?

首先,打開html編輯器,新建html文件,例如:index.html,并引入jquery。

//1,不傳遞參數(shù),返回這個(gè)元素在同輩中的索引位置。

jquery提供了獲得第一個(gè)匹配元素相對(duì)于其同胞元素的位置的方法——index(),注意:index從0開始計(jì)數(shù) 如果未找到元素,index() 將返回 -1。

基本思路:遍歷select下的option,使用val()獲取每個(gè)option的值,然后加入到一個(gè)數(shù)組中。根據(jù)這個(gè)思路,可以使用for循環(huán)或者jQuery的each()遍歷函數(shù)實(shí)現(xiàn)。

如何用jquery查找字符串,并且定位到字符串所在位置?

將其放入一個(gè)數(shù)組,通過split函數(shù):代碼如下:結(jié)果如下:已在一個(gè)數(shù)組。

replaceWith(),將所有匹配的元素替換成指定的HTML或DOM元素。示例:把所有的段落標(biāo)記替換成加粗的標(biāo)記。

// 取出所有class屬性開頭是 skin- 的元素[].slice.apply(document.querySelectorAll([class^=skin-]))// 如果skin-不在開頭,在中間也可以。

jquery如何獲取表格的一行,并且獲取其索引?

jQuery 提供了index()方法用于獲取第一個(gè)匹配元素相對(duì)于其同胞元素的 index 位置(從0開始計(jì)數(shù)),基本語法為:$(selector).index()。因此當(dāng)前 tr 的 index 可以得到行數(shù),當(dāng)前 td 的 index 可以得到列數(shù)。

.parent(tr).prevAll().length+1;var colum = $(this).prevAll().length+1;alert(選中的是第+row+行,第+colum+列。

jquery獲取元素索引值index()方法:jquery的index()方法 搜索匹配的元素,并返回相應(yīng)元素的索引值,從0開始計(jì)數(shù)。如果不給 .index()方法傳遞參數(shù),那么返回值就是這個(gè)jQuery對(duì)象集合中第一個(gè)元素相對(duì)于其同輩元素的位置。

在每個(gè)td標(biāo)簽內(nèi)部添加onclick,你不覺得麻煩,jquery開發(fā)者看到會(huì)被氣死的。

可以使用prev函數(shù),一直查找前一個(gè)元素并計(jì)數(shù),直到?jīng)]有前一個(gè)元素。根據(jù)計(jì)數(shù),可以知道當(dāng)前的索引值。

當(dāng)前題目:jquery索引 jquery實(shí)現(xiàn)搜索功能
本文來源:http://muchs.cn/article15/diihogi.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站制作、企業(yè)建站軟件開發(fā)、定制開發(fā)響應(yīng)式網(wǎng)站、靜態(tài)網(wǎng)站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

微信小程序開發(fā)